LXI High Voltage Matrix 2-Pole 100x2
60-310-102
The 60-310 is a 2-pole Matrix Module available in 300x2, 200x2 and 100x2 formats. It is capable of cold switching 1000VDC and has a maximum carry current of 1A. It is designed for high voltage applications including circuit board isolation testing, relay testing, semiconductor breakdown monitoring and cable harness insulation testing. The 60-310 is designed in accordance with the LXI Standard 1.4 and is supplied in a 2U high, full rack width case with 500mm depth.

LXI WTB Probe, Terminated
60-981-002
The 60-981 LXI Wired Trigger Probe provides a simple method of monitoring the LXI Wired Trigger Bus activity. It provides a through line active probe that can be used to non-intrusively monitor the waveforms of the M-LVDS drivers on all 8 channels. Each channel has two single ended outputs from the differential pair that can be subtracted by an oscilloscope to display each driver output and the differential signal.

LXI WTB Adaptor, Thru line
60-982-001
The 60-982 provides a effective method of adapting trigger signals from bench instruments to the LXI Wired Trigger Bus signalling standard. The 60-982 converts M-LVDS signals on the WTB to Low Voltage TTL signals and converts Low Voltage TTL signals to M-LVDS. All 8 channels of the LXI WTB are supported in a single adaptor. Each channel of the WTB can be configured either manually or through a digital I/O to be Disabled, Driven or in Wired OR mode. The interface is fully compatible with the LXI WTB standard and counts as one node on the bus.

product
LXI WTB Terminator, 90.6 ohm
60-983-002
The 60-983 is an LXI compatible Wired Trigger Bus Terminator (WTB) designed to be attached to the end of a WTB cable. The LXI WTB uses a transmission line cable to connect LXI devices together that support the WTB capability of the LXI standard. Like all transmissions it needs to be correctly terminated to avoid reflections that could change the signal amplitude along the cable and generate timing jitter or trigger errors. The 60-983 is a simple terminator that can be placed at each end of the WTB chain to correctly terminate the transmission line with minimal reflections.
